Notes
1. For all register accesses, CSB must be low.
2. Writing any value to any of the PMON(314H to 31FH), RXCP-50(369H to 370H) or TXCP-50(386H to
388H) counter holding registers will latch the current count value to the holding registers. To ensure that
the transfer was completed a wait function must be performed via software as indicated by the specific
count registers being latched. Each of the above mentioned registers have a specified clock cycle
completion requirement that is stated in the specific count registers description. For example the LCV
PMON count of registers 314H and 315H specifies that it takes three RCLK cycles to complete a
transfer of the current count value to the count holding registers. Other registers may specify a different
clock cycle requirement for the three different operational modes of the JET: DS3, E3 and J2.
